#69130c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#69130c is composed of 41.2% red, 7.5%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 81.9% magenta, 88.6% yellow and 58.8% black. It has a hue angle of 4.5 degrees, a saturation of 79.5% and a lightness of 22.9%. #69130c color hex could be obtained by blending #d22618 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#69130c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#69130c has RGB values of R:105, G:19,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.82, Y:0.89,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 6886156.

Shades and Tints of #69130c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110302 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#69130c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3c3939 is the less saturated color, while #720b03 is the most saturated one.
